Lincolnwood, Illinois: Passport Books / National Textbook Company, 1988. First Edition. Cloth and boards. Very Fine/Very Fine. Alisa Mueller Burkey. 8vo, brown cloth with gold lettering on spine over tan boards, illustrated with 15 B&W maps for walking by Alisa Mueller Burkey, Mylar-protected pictorial dust jacket set in an English village with Sherlock Holmes & Dr. Watson investigating behind Agatha Christie, map endpapers, xv + 416 pages. Tight, bright, unmarked copy in a Superior dust jacket! (See also the authors' Walking Guide to London.).
